Abstract

An appropriate plan of fire and gas frameworks starts with the determination of an exhibition focus for capacities utilized by the fire and gas framework. Then, the execution of a fire and gas framework is essentially portrayed by the framework's ability to distinguish dangers (indicator inclusion) and the framework's capacity to moderate risks. The objective of this research is to improve the system that detects gas as well as fire outbreaks and use gsm module to notify the user via message as soon as possible for that user can take appropriate action to control it. This system makes use of a microcontroller along with a sensing circuit that will detect gas leakage and fire with the help of an alarm system that gives alerts about fire or gas leakage. With the installation of a GSM modem, SMS are sent to notify the user if there is fire or gas leakage, and if the fire occurs, the water sprinkler sprinkles water on the affected area to reduce the effect of the fire. An MQ2 gas sensor is used to build the system, and on testing, the system gave adequate information and timely alert as SMS on detecting the gas leakage. The fire detection can also be carried out by using the temperature sensor (Waterproof DS18B20), which detects the fire in the working area and alert SMS is sent to the user. Also, an excess temperature detection system is implemented using a temperature sensor to detect the excess temperature beyond the preset value.
